About The Position

Leidos Defense is seeking an experienced Integrated Master Schedule Coordinator to support the Indo-Pacific Logistics and Sustainment Services (ILS2) program. ILS2 provides integrated logistics, facilities, mission-enabling, training, and emergent operations support across the geographically dispersed Indo-Pacific Area of Responsibility (AOR). The Integrated Master Schedule Coordinator will support the ILS2 Program Management Office (PMO) by developing, maintaining, analyzing, and reporting integrated project schedules that enable disciplined execution across multiple concurrent projects, locations, mission partners, and task areas. Working closely with the Operations Manager, Project Plan Managers, Resource Managers, Task Leads, Mission Partner Liaisons, and technical and operational teams, the IMS Coordinator will provide the schedule visibility and analysis needed to identify dependencies, assess schedule risk, coordinate resources, and maintain alignment with Government priorities. The successful candidate will support project planning and execution across logistics operations, facilities planning and implementation, mission-enabling services, and emergent operations. The position requires the ability to operate in a dynamic environment where mission priorities, geographic constraints, resource availability, deployment requirements, and contingency operations can affect project schedules and execution.

Responsibilities

  • Develop, maintain, and analyze the ILS2 Integrated Master Schedule (IMS) and supporting project schedules across multiple concurrent projects and task areas.
  • Work with Operations Manager, Project Plan Managers, Task Leads, Resource Managers, and technical personnel to develop project schedules containing activities, milestones, dependencies, deliverables, resource requirements, and Government decision points.
  • Integrate individual project schedules into the program-level IMS to provide leadership and the Government with visibility into execution across the ILS2 enterprise.
  • Analyze schedule performance, critical paths, dependencies, constraints, and emerging risks that could affect cost, schedule, performance, or mission readiness.
  • Conduct schedule health assessments and recommend corrective actions to mitigate schedule delays and execution risk.
  • Track project progress against approved baselines and provide recurring schedule status, variance analysis, forecasts, and trend information to program leadership.
  • Coordinate with Resource Managers to identify resource requirements, staffing dependencies, workforce availability, and potential resource constraints affecting scheduled activities.
  • Support development and maintenance of project plans, work breakdown structures (WBSs), milestones, deliverables, and other program and project management artifacts.
  • Support integration of logistics, facilities, deployment, training, mission-support, and other cross-functional activities into executable project schedules.
  • Identify and track dependencies among ILS2 task areas, Mission Partners, Government organizations, teammates, vendors, and other supporting organizations.
  • Support schedule planning for transition, deployment, contingency, surge, and emergent operational requirements.
  • Develop schedule-related metrics, reports, dashboards, charts, and briefings that provide leadership with actionable insight into project and program performance.
  • Participate in project reviews, status meetings, planning sessions, risk reviews, and other program management business rhythms.
  • Support what-if and scenario analyses to evaluate the schedule effects of changing priorities, resource constraints, emerging requirements, and contingency operations.
  • Maintain schedule documentation, assumptions, baseline changes, and supporting project records in Government- and program-approved systems.
  • Capture schedule lessons learned and recommend process improvements that strengthen planning, forecasting, and execution across the ILS2 enterprise.
